Day 14 of '75 Days of Partition' - To distinguish the displaced people of Partition, contemporary archaeologist Dr. Erin Riggs has visited evacuee properties and studied government housing schemes in Delhi. Although these places have undergone a lot of change over the years, she brings them back through visual representations and oral accounts. Dr. Erin Riggs is an Assistant Professor at University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ign. Join us to know more about her research and work on 'Refugee resettlement housing in Delhi'. 75 Days of Partition' is a daily micro podcast series being aired for 75 days between June 3rd, 2022 and August 17th, 2022 (except Sundays) to commemorate the 75th anniversary of Partition in 2022. The series will entail live conversation bursts with historians, film makers, authors, art-makers and other practitioners working on uncovering and understanding the history of Partition. For context, August 17th is the day the boundary commission announced the Radcliffe Line separating India and Pakistan, 75 days after the Partition Plan was announced on June 3rd, 1947.
